Our opinion

Overlooking the Meuse on a rocky outcrop, this impressive stronghold once defended the southern boundary of the principality. The estate includes a classical-style chateau dating from the 18th century, built in a U-shape. The west wing is particularly noteworthy, featuring a circular tower dating back to the late Middle Ages. The building has endured the ravages of time and is in need of extensive renovation. Nonetheless, it contains vast reception rooms where some original decorative features have survived. The property also includes an old orangery, a caretaker's lodge and garages topped with haylofts. Finally, the gardens are terraced and walled. They offer uninterrupted views over the mighty river meandering below towards the great monuments of "Little France on the banks of the Meuse", as Jules Michelet called this region.
